Transaction df1ef695a45957cc39898ffd4078031ed359f43df76d9de141e65ab7627985b1
1 Input
1 Output
-
df1ef695a45957cc39898ffd4078031ed359f43df76d9de141e65ab7627985b1:0
- value
- 2693884
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de7e44e79622292a972ff0b6c8125af5516dfcc24cc5b0716a75430ced420209
- address
- bc1pmelyfeukyg5j49e07zmvsyj674gkmlxzfnzmqut2w4psem2zqgysg3wcqv